Форум: "Базы";
Текущий архив: 2005.02.27;
Скачать: [xml.tar.bz2];
ВнизОбновление данных в дбгриде Найти похожие ветки
← →
Кук (2005-01-26 14:04) [0]Пролемка маленькая.
Почему данные вводимые на 1-ом клиенте не отображаются на других.
При клике на кнопку "Обновить" происходит: TIBDataSet1.Refresh;
пробовал также:
TIBDataSet1.Close;
TIBDataSet1.Open;
Какой вариант лучше?
Как сделать так, чтобы при нажатии на "Обновить" отображались то что ввёл другой клиент?
← →
Sergey13 © (2005-01-26 14:09) [1]"Другой" должен сделать COMMIT.
← →
HSolo © (2005-01-26 14:12) [2]Обратите внимание на уровень изоляции транзакции у того, кто должен увидеть изменения
← →
Кук (2005-01-26 14:20) [3]Тот что вводит, делаю CommitRetaining, а другой обновляет свои данные в дбгиде, но ничего не происходит, или надо действительно делать Commit, а потом открывать все запросы заново?
← →
Кук (2005-01-26 14:22) [4]read_committed
rec_version
nowait
← →
msguns © (2005-01-26 14:38) [5]Так как происходит обновление у "читающего" клиента? Переоткрытием или рефрешем - это ведь совсем не одно и то же.
← →
Digitman © (2005-01-26 14:54) [6]
> Почему данные вводимые на 1-ом клиенте
клиентом в дан.случае следует считать отдельный объект TIBDatabase, имеющий Active = True, и ничто иное.
← →
Кук (2005-01-26 22:08) [7]наверно пример бы мне помог, какой код у вас назначен на кнопки
"Записать" ("Отправить на сервер" или "ОК") и "Обновить"
Заранее спасибо :-)
← →
Кук (2005-01-28 11:27) [8]ау :-)
ну вы же знаете ответ и на то, чтобы ответить много времени у вас не уйдёт
← →
Alexandr © (2005-01-28 11:30) [9]ау!!!
ну вы же знаете что у вас в кармане есть 100$ и чтобы выслать их мне много времени у вас не уйдет.
Страницы: 1 вся ветка
Форум: "Базы";
Текущий архив: 2005.02.27;
Скачать: [xml.tar.bz2];
Память: 0.46 MB
Время: 0.046 c